Foundation underpinning is a critical construction process employed to strengthen and stabilize the foundations of existing structures. This method becomes essential when a building's foundation is no longer capable of supporting the structure above it due to reasons such as soil instability, natural disasters, or the need to accommodate additional loads from renovations. By extending the foundation depth or distributing the building's load across a more stable surface, underpinning ensures the safety and longevity of the structure. This process not only mitigates the risk of structural failure but also enhances the overall value and integrity of the property. Proper underpinning can prevent costly repairs in the future and maintain the safety and usability of a building.
Benefits of Foundation Underpinning
-
Increased Structural Stability
Foundation underpinning significantly boosts the structural stability of a building. By reinforcing the foundation, it addresses issues such as settling or shifting, which can lead to cracks and damage. This increased stability ensures that the building remains safe and secure for occupants. -
Enhanced Property Value
Investing in foundation underpinning can enhance the value of a property. A well-supported foundation is a critical selling point for potential buyers and can lead to a better return on investment. It assures prospective owners that the property is structurally sound and less likely to require major repairs in the future. -
Prevention of Further Damage
By addressing foundation issues early through underpinning, property owners can prevent further damage to the structure. This proactive approach can save significant costs associated with repairing extensive damage caused by a failing foundation. It also helps in maintaining the aesthetic appeal of the building by preventing unsightly cracks and other structural issues.
